Picture at right is a photo of Olga's headstone and footstone. It is a matching headstone of her brother Oscar Malvin, which can be seen at the cemetery to the right of where Olga is buried.

Olga was baptized as "Olga Mathilde Kvalevaag".

Olga Martilde died when she was only 3 and 1/2, but, became the namesake of her sister, Olga Mathilda (Kvalevog-Carlson).

Transcription reads "Reiste til et bedre land", which translates to "Traveled to a better land".
